What role does insulin play regarding bone strength?

Explanation:
Insulin plays a significant role in maintaining bone strength and health. It is involved in the regulation of several cellular processes related to bone metabolism. One of the key functions of insulin is to promote the uptake of glucose and other nutrients by cells, which supports the energy needs of osteoblasts (the cells responsible for bone formation). Furthermore, insulin directly influences the activity of osteoblasts, enhancing their proliferation and differentiation, which contributes to an increase in bone density and strength. Additionally, insulin has been shown to have a protective effect against bone resorption, which is the process by which bone is broken down and its minerals released into the bloodstream. This balance between formation and resorption is crucial for maintaining healthy bone structure. Overall, the positive effects of insulin on bone health underscore its importance in bone metabolism, making its contribution to keeping bones strong well-supported by research and clinical findings.
